Learn About History and Culture
Photo courtesy of Montgomery’s Inn
Ideal for art lovers and history buffs, Etobicoke is the perfect place to explore and expand your cultural repertoire. Visit the Etobicoke Civic Centre Art Gallery to enjoy local, national and international art or spend the day at Montgomery’s Inn, a community museum with almost 180 years of history.
Attend an Event
Photo courtesy of Street Classics
There’s no such thing as an uneventful day in Etobicoke with fun-filled events taking place all summer long. Get to know your neighbours at local events, like the Montgomery’s Inn Farmers Market, where you can shop for local produce, meats and treats, Street Classics Cruise where you can admire classic cars every weekend with other enthusiasts. And last but not least Lakeshore Mardi Gras, another event you definitely don’t want to miss, with music, food, vendors and so much more, it’s perfect for the whole family.
